A man’s appeared in court over allegations he had more than £22,000 worth of heroin.
Scott Eric Carbutt of Waterloo Road in Ramsey appeared before Deputy High Bailiff James Brooks.
The 40-year-old entered no plea to a single count of possessing the class A drug with intent to supply it on January 14.
Prosecutor Hazel Carroon told the court Mr Carbutt was stopped by police as he was about to get into a Mini in a car park – the car sped away but police managed to stop it on Ballure Road in Maughold.
Officers discovered the suspected drugs inside, and have sent them away for forensic tests.
Mr Brooks granted bail in the sum of £500 and Mr Carbutt will appear in court again on March 22.
